Code
#include <iostream>
#include <vector>
#include <algorithm>
#include <random>
#include <time.h>
int main() {
clock_t c0 = clock();
std::mt19937 gen;
int n;
std::cin >> n;
std::vector<int> p(n), a(n), a0;
a.reserve(n);
a0.reserve(n);
long e = 0;
for (int i = 0; i < n; ++i) {
std::cin >> p[i];
a[i] = p[i];
e += p[i];
}
e /= 2;
a0 = a;
long e0 = e;
while (e0 != 0 && (clock() - c0) * 1.0 / CLOCKS_PER_SEC < 0.90) {
for (int i = 0; i < 10000; ++i) {
for (int j = a.size(); j--;) {
std::swap(a[j], a[gen() % a.size()]);
}
for (int& j: a) {
if ((e < 0) == (j < 0)) {
e -= j;
j = -j;
}
if (std::abs(e) < e0) {
e0 = std::abs(e);
a0 = a;
if (e0 == 0) {
goto done;
}
}
}
}
}
done:
for (int i: p) {
auto j = std::find(a0.begin(), a0.end(), i);
if (j != a0.end()) {
a0.erase(j);
std::cout << "1 ";
} else {
std::cout << "2 ";
}
}
std::cout << "\n";
}
